Solar Power: A Rural Indian Hospital’s Key to Fighting COVID-19
Summary
This case study by the World Resources Institute describes how Nav Jivan Hospital in rural India improved its resilience and capacity to treat COVID-19 patients by installing a 10-kilowatt peak (kWp) solar photovoltaic (PV) system to mitigate unreliable grid electricity.
Key insights
- Nav Jivan Hospital installed a 10-kilowatt peak (kWp) solar photovoltaic (PV) system in January to address operational challenges caused by erratic electric supply and regular voltage fluctuations. While the system does not power the entire facility, it stabilizes critical operations in the intensive care unit (ICU), specifically powering ventilators used for COVID-19 patients.
- Before adopting solar energy, Nav Jivan Hospital relied on a three-phase grid connection plagued by frequent outages and monsoon-related damage, forcing a dependence on polluting diesel generators that cost over $13,000 (Rs.10 lakh) per year. In earlier years, the hospital was forced to conduct child deliveries and surgeries using petromax lamps and flashlights.
- Rural healthcare infrastructure in India faces significant energy deficits: as of 2019, approximately 40,000 sub-centers (at least 30% of those in 14 states) lacked electricity connections, and nearly 800 primary health centers (PHCs) operated without power.
- The document argues that decentralized renewable energy can enhance the resilience of rural health systems by providing uninterrupted services, reducing pollution and diesel costs, and improving financial efficiency.
